About Course

This course provides an introduction to Home Economics, covering its meaning, scope, and importance. It explores the human body, its parts, and functions, followed by a focus on food and nutrition, including food classification and sources. Students will learn about kitchen equipment and utensils, as well as basic needlecraft techniques. The course also covers simple sewing tools and delves into knitting and crocheting, offering hands-on skills for everyday life.
